Dear TYPO3 users,
Several vulnerabilities have been found in the following third party TYPO3
extensions: "phpMyAdmin" (phpmyadmin), "Apache Solr Search" (solr), "Random
Images" (maag_randomimage), "Flagbit Filebase" (fb_filebase), "freeCap
CAPTCHA" (sr_freecap)
For further information on the issue in extension "phpMyAdmin" (phpmyadmin)
please read the related advisory TYPO3-SA-2009-015 that was published today:
<http://typo3.org/teams/security/security-bulletins/typo3-sa-2009-015/>
For further information on all CSB (Collective Security Bulletin) issues,
please read the related advisory TYPO3-SA-2009-014 that was published today:
<http://typo3.org/teams/security/security-bulletins/typo3-sa-2009-014/>
